GentooRepository/app-editors/neovim
Vadim Misbakh-Soloviov adae2e2739
app-editors/neovim: bump minimal tree-sitter version
Some time ago neovim's upstream made some changes that made it incompatible with <dev-libs/tree-sitter-0.20.9.

For example, this leads to following build failure:

/usr/lib/gcc/x86_64-pc-linux-gnu/13/../../../../x86_64-pc-linux-gnu/bin/ld: src/nvim/CMakeFiles/nvim_bin.dir/lua/treesitter.c.o: in function `node_rawquery':
treesitter.c:(.text+0x3583): undefined reference to `ts_query_cursor_set_max_start_depth'
/usr/lib/gcc/x86_64-pc-linux-gnu/13/../../../../x86_64-pc-linux-gnu/bin/ld: treesitter.c:(.text+0x3777): undefined reference to `ts_query_cursor_set_max_start_depth'
collect2: error: ld returned 1 exit status

Closes: https://bugs.gentoo.org/922963
Closes: https://bugs.gentoo.org/925193
Signed-off-by: Vadim Misbakh-Soloviov <mva@gentoo.org>
2024-02-22 14:16:29 +07:00
..
files app-editors/neovim: Rebase patch from upstream 2023-12-28 04:46:20 +00:00
Manifest app-editors/neovim: drop 0.9.2, 0.9.3 2024-02-07 16:10:38 +02:00
metadata.xml profiles/use.desc: Make USE=lto global 2023-12-18 19:52:37 +01:00
neovim-0.9.4.ebuild app-editors/neovim: [QA] Remove invalid USE=lto 2024-01-07 12:37:40 +01:00
neovim-0.9.5.ebuild app-editors/neovim: Stabilize 0.9.5 amd64, #922801 2024-01-24 13:07:01 +00:00
neovim-9999.ebuild app-editors/neovim: bump minimal tree-sitter version 2024-02-22 14:16:29 +07:00